Output 0076189c5e8dddbfb079d2539c9972f32963399a47a4bb29c72e20fb536ab47c:8

value
621343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88574b6641a9abd88afffc61482c8bbb5b54aff OP_EQUAL
address
3H45KT583xGyVJ4crDByWwAKrEedYFwY3w
transaction
0076189c5e8dddbfb079d2539c9972f32963399a47a4bb29c72e20fb536ab47c
spent
true